Baghdad jewelry store robberies lead to 15 deaths

Fourteen people were killed in southwestern Baghdad on Tuesday when more than 10 gunmen stormed jewelry stores, and a gunman was killed later in clashes between police and the robbers, police said.

Most of the victims were jewelers, officials said, adding that gunmen managed to flee the area after they had stolen gold and cash from 11 stores.

Officials said the gunmen also planted bombs near the stores in order to create chaos so they could flee the area easily.

Iraqi security forces arrived on scene at the Bayaa neighborhood and sealed off the area.

After the robberies, attackers and police battled in a different location in Bayaa. A gunman was slain and four police were wounded.
